Description
Abbey Property Sales offer this 3 bed home to the market with c 3 acres of land.
The property has been vacant for a number of years and will qualify for the 50/70k council grant for derelict homes.
BER. F.
Eircode N41Y284
This is a great opportunity to purchase a semi modern home for a reasonable price.
The property had pve double glazed windows & doors installed a number of years ago and don’t require replacing.
The owner had started work on the internal part of the house & it is now ready for completion.
The dwelling is situated in a lovely rural area just off the Mohill to Keshcarrigan road.
Accommodation.
Entrance Hall. 4.68 m x 1.56 m.
Sitting Room. 5.08 m x 3.40 m. large windows for dual aspect & brightness.
Kitchen/Dining Room. 3.64 m x 2.90 m.
Bedroom 1. 4.57 m x 3.44 m.
Bedroom 2. 3.70 m x 3.01 m.
Bedroom 3. 2.93 m x 2.45 m
Bathroom. 2.44 m x 1.98 m.
Features.
Dwelling house in need of repairs on c 3 acres, electricity still connected, mains water, septic tank, there are a number of outbuildings with the property, lovely countryside location,
